Embracing Healthy Living Strategies for Everyday Wellness


When we talk about healthy living strategies, we’re really discussing simple, sustainable habits that support our overall well-being. These strategies are not about drastic changes or quick fixes. Instead, they focus on small, consistent steps that add up over time.


For example, instead of overhauling your entire diet overnight, try adding one extra serving of vegetables to your meals each day. Or, if exercise feels daunting, start with a 10-minute walk around your neighborhood. These small actions build momentum and confidence.


Here are some practical healthy living strategies to consider:


  • Prioritize Sleep: Aim for 7-9 hours of restful sleep. Create a calming bedtime routine and keep your sleep environment comfortable.

  • Stay Hydrated: Drinking enough water supports energy and focus. Carry a reusable water bottle to remind yourself.

  • Mindful Eating: Pay attention to hunger cues and savor your food. This helps prevent overeating and promotes digestion.

  • Regular Movement: Find activities you enjoy, whether it’s yoga, dancing, or gardening. Movement should feel good, not like a chore.

  • Stress Management: Practice deep breathing, meditation, or journaling to ease tension and clear your mind.


By weaving these strategies into your daily life, you create a foundation for lasting health and happiness.

What are the 7 components of a healthy lifestyle?


Understanding the key components of a healthy lifestyle can guide us in making balanced choices. These seven pillars support our well-being and help us thrive:


  1. Balanced Nutrition: Eating a variety of whole foods that provide essential nutrients.

  2. Physical Activity: Engaging in regular exercise that suits your preferences and abilities.

  3. Adequate Sleep: Prioritizing restful sleep to restore and rejuvenate the body.

  4. Stress Management: Using techniques to reduce and cope with stress effectively.

  5. Hydration: Drinking enough water to maintain bodily functions.

  6. Social Connections: Building and maintaining supportive relationships.

  7. Mental Health Care: Attending to emotional well-being through mindfulness, therapy, or self-care.


Each component plays a vital role, and neglecting one can affect the others. For instance, poor sleep can increase stress, which might lead to unhealthy eating habits. Recognizing this interconnectedness encourages us to approach health holistically.


By focusing on these seven areas, you can create a personalized plan that fits your lifestyle and goals.

Practical Tips for Seamless Healthy Lifestyle Integration


Integrating healthy habits into a busy life can feel overwhelming, but it doesn’t have to be. The key is to start small and build gradually. Here are some tips that have made a difference for me and others:


  • Set Realistic Goals: Instead of aiming for perfection, choose achievable targets. For example, commit to walking three times a week rather than daily.

  • Create a Routine: Consistency helps habits stick. Try to do your wellness activities at the same time each day.

  • Use Reminders: Place notes or alarms to prompt healthy actions, like drinking water or stretching.

  • Find Support: Share your goals with friends or join a community. Encouragement and accountability boost motivation.

  • Celebrate Progress: Acknowledge your efforts, no matter how small. Positive reinforcement keeps you moving forward.


Remember, healthy lifestyle integration is a journey unique to each person. It’s about finding what works for you and honoring your pace.
